Presidio Launches First EMC-Validated Solution Center Supporting Hybrid Cloud Management

By Laura Stotler

Presidio has opened the first EMC-validated Platinum Solution Center in Woburn, Mass., to showcase its Presidio Managed Cloud offering. The facility is a complete ecosystem built to EMC specifications and offering Presidio’s enterprise hybrid cloud management as a service as well as dozens of integrated EMC and VMware products.

The partnership is the latest in a spate of announcements promoting the federation of multi-cloud and hybrid cloud environments. For its part, EMC solidified its hybrid cloud strategy just last week with the rollout of its EMC Hybrid Cloud Solution. The offering works with a variety of public cloud services including AWS and Microsoft Azure as well as EMC-powered cloud service providers like Presidio.

The new Solutions Center offers private and public cloud functionality and management from both Presidio and VMware as well as EMC Hybrid Cloud offerings. The EMC Hybrid Cloud is built with both Microsoft and OpenStack technology, stemming from EMC’s recent acquisition of cloud technology companies Cloudscaling, Maginatics and Spanning. The companies all use OpenStack to accelerate adoption and federation of hybrid cloud environments.

"In the last two years, we have built out our capabilities in design, implementation, and support of large-scale hybrid cloud solutions utilizing EMC and VMware technology," said Raphael Meyerowitz, assistant vice president of data center services at Presidio. "Our hybrid cloud solution center along with Presidio's Managed Cloud service catalog management allows us to demonstrate to clients the power of EMC and VMware technology to provision compute, storage, and custom services as well as manage, monitor, and cost quantify them through their full lifecycle."

The announcement follows OpenStack platform provider Siara’s news that it had completed a successful proof of concept with MSP KVH’s customers. The service provider is offering the platform to federate a wide variety of cloud deployments through a single cloud and WAN orchestration interface based on Siara’s cloudScape platform, which uses OpenStack.
